Q:I am taking a cruise from port Canaveral usa to the western Caribbean on feb 22- Feb 29 and I am looking for a travel insurance that will cover my pre existing condition if I were to have an acute attack while traveling. Also repatriation if needed. I am 65.

A:
Most of the Trip plans available on our website will cover pre-existing conditions as long as the plan is purchased within a certain number of days of the initial trip deposit. The number of days range from around 15 days to 30 days depending on the plan you choose.

Q:I am a US citizen (currently living in India with my wife) am likely to visit New York, USA with my wife (an Indian citizen). While I am 62 year old, my wife is 60. We are looking for Health insurance quotes for both of us during our intended stay in the USA from 2nd Dec to 28th Dec 2019 for a coverage between $130,000 to $200,000. May I request you provide the quotes.

A:
We would be glad to assist. Because you and your spouse have differing citizenship, you will need to be on individual policies. We have sent 2 quotes, the first for you and the second quote for your spouse in a separate email The plans available to you as a U.S. citizen visiting the U.S. are limited and the plans available do not offer policy maximums between $130,000-$200,000. Therefore the quotes were sent with $100,000 policy maximums. The next higher policy maximum on the plans available to you would be $500,000. Your spouse will have more options, and while we sent her quotes at the $100,000 policy maximum as well, you can choose from higher policy maximums for her if you choose. Q:I want to buy travel insurance to Vietnam & Cambodia. Can I get both destinations in one policy or I have to buy 2?

A:
The plans in our Travel outside the U.S. section of our website, will cover you anywhere outside your home country as long as your travel does not include the U.S. which per your below information does not. Therefore, you would only need 1 plan and it would cover in both places. You may view the Travel outside the U.S. plans here. Please let us know if you have any additional questions.
